Holograph fair copy by William Baines of 'The Naiad' for pianoforte, dedicated to Frederick Dawson and dated 'York. Feb. 11th 1920'; printed as no. 2 of Three concert studies (London, 1923).

(fols. 6-16 are blank)

Biographical / Historical

William Baines (1899-1922) was a composer.

Immediate Source of Acquisition

Given by Frederick Dawson through Friends of the Bodleian, 1930. See Friends of the Bodleian Annual Report V, 1929-1930, p. 12.

Physical Facet

bound by Maltby of Oxford in quarter red morocco
